Outdoor Stairs Painting in Waco, TX
Outdoor stairs painting services involve applying durable and weather-resistant coatings to enhance the appearance and longevity of exterior staircases. This service covers a variety of projects, including front porch steps, backyard stairways, and commercial or multi-unit property stairs. Homeowners typically seek this service to improve curb appeal, protect wood or concrete surfaces from the elements, and ensure safety by providing a clear, visible surface with slip-resistant finishes.
Before requesting outdoor stairs painting, property owners usually want to understand the scope of preparation required, such as cleaning, sanding, or repairing surfaces prior to painting. They also often inquire about the types of paints or coatings used, the expected durability, and whether the work includes both steps and railings.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project meets aesthetic preferences and withstands outdoor conditions over time.

Outdoor Stairs Painting Questions
What types of outdoor stairs can be painted? Various outdoor stairs, including concrete, wood, and metal, can be painted to improve appearance and durability.
Is outdoor stairs painting suitable for all weather conditions? Painting is best done in dry weather to ensure proper adhesion and curing, with consideration for temperature and humidity.
How often should outdoor stairs be repainted? Repainting typically depends on wear and exposure, but regular inspections can help determine when a fresh coat is needed.
What preparations are needed before painting outdoor stairs? Surfaces should be cleaned, repaired if necessary, and properly primed to ensure the best paint adhesion and finish.
